Oakland, California-based artist Chris Duncan doesn't have to look far for inspiration. Duncan is a punk mystic, known for geometry, bright colors, string sculpture, and head-scratching titles. Though his work is abstract, his inspirations are close at hand–community, friends, headlines, and most of all, his daughter Aya. Here, we look at his work, his day, and his latest show at San Francisco's Luggage Store gallery.
